Abstract:
The sulfomethylated lignoamine was prepared with masson pine lignosulphate by Mannich reaction and sulfonation reaction. Then the organic-inorganic compound modified lignin-based flocculant could be obtained by further mixing with sodium aluminate solution. The modified lignin-based flocculant was adopted to treat the antibiotics pharmaceutical effluent. The flocculation conditions were optimized. The removal rates of CODCr, SS and colourity of the effluent could reach 61.2%, 96.7% and 91.6% respectively under such conditions as effluent pH value 6.0 and flocculant dosage 120 mg/L etc. Moreover, the comparison tests with various flocculants indicated that the flocculation performance of the modified lignin-based flocculant apparently prevailed over such flocculants as polyacrylamide (PAM), polyferric sulfate (PFS), potassium aluminium sulfate (PAS) and ferrous sulfate (FS) etc.
